Abstract

With the rapid development of high-tech in the world, the high-tech industry system based on high-tech development has more and more room for development. High-tech enterprises have become the main industry for competition among countries in the world by taking advantage of their strong product correlation, high added value, low pollution and low energy reserves. This study explores the value assessment methods of high-tech enterprises and the characteristic problems existing in value assessment, and proposes corresponding solutions and coping strategies.
